We are looking for a full-time application developer with exceptional talent, an abundance of energy, and a high-degree of self-motivation. We are a fast growing, ambitious company in an emerging market, making this a challenging position not suitable for novices. The ideal candidate has expertise in the areas of:

* PHP
* MySQL
* JavaScript
* HTML
* CSS
* XML
* Red Hat Linux


Our architecture is object based, so a solid understanding of object oriented programming concepts and principles is crucial. Some experience with other languages such as Perl, C++, .NET, etc. would be beneficial. Excellent written communication, organizational, and time-management skills, and a conscientious nature are required.

This position is based in our NYC office. This is not a contract position or a remote position.

About Optimost:
Optimost is the leading provider of multivariable testing solutions for companies doing business on the web. We help our clients maximize their conversion rates online through real-time testing of landing pages, registration pages, and other points of customer interaction. Our large and varied client list includes leading brands such as AOL, Bank of America, Time Life, Delta Airlines, Dun & Bradstreet, and HP. Optimost is a six year old, rapidly-growing company and a leader in this emerging market space. Optimost is headquartered in New York City, with offices in the San Francisco Bay area, and London, England.
